What starts you on your path – and what prevents you from taking that first step?

While there are many contributing factors, consider this concept: you don’t start a bonfire; you light a spark. Those who are so focused on lighting the bonfire often give up. The enormity of the big picture prevents us from knowing where (or how) to start. And doing nothing takes less effort than doing something.

What are the sparks?

  • identifying the one or two baby steps, to help you get going.
  • finding the low hanging fruit – those tasks that are easy to do, and yield great benefit
  • motivating others to buy in to your project
  • delegating an early task to someone who is keen to run with it.
